What does the word "Henrique" mean?

The name "Henrique" is of Portuguese origin and is commonly used in Portuguese-speaking countries, particularly in Portugal and Brazil. It is derived from the Germanic name "Heinrich," which is composed of two elements: "heim," meaning home or estate, and "rich," meaning ruler or power. Thus, the name can be interpreted as "ruler of the home" or "home ruler." This etymology reflects the significance of leadership and authority often associated with individuals bearing this name.

In modern times, the name Henrique continues to be favored in many families. Its cultural resonance is strong, with parents often choosing it for its heritage and historical weight. Moreover, the name is versatile, fitting in well with various surnames and regional adaptations. In Brazil, for instance, it can be shortened to "Henri" or "Rique" in informal settings, showcasing its lively adaptation in everyday life.
